Supreme Court notice to Centre on PIL seeking ban on plastic bags

NEW DELHI: The Supreme Court today issued notice to the Centre and plastic bag manufacturing companies on a plea seeking complete ban on usage of plastic bags in the country.

A bench headed by Justice G S Singhvi also sought the government's response on the plea to put in place a proper mechanism for disposal of used plastic bags.

The apex court passed the order on a PIL filed by a NGO, Karuna Society, seeking its direction to government to ban the use of plastic bags.

Observing that the issue raised by the petitioner should be given a serious thought, the bench agreed to hear the PIL and also issued notice to the Centre and plastic bag manufacturing companies.
